A demand for an urgent investigation and the driving out of anti-Semitism in a number of factories in Kazan was voiced by the “Comsomolskaya Pravda,” Communist youth organ.
A number of workers marched through the streets of Kazan singing anti-Semitic songs, with no attempt to stop them, the paper complains.
